The present system is to
call a national freephone number to register as unemployed. You will then need
to carry out a telephone interview with a Jobcentre plus advisor.
If necessary an
appointment will then be made with your nearest Jobcentre plus office where a
one to one interview will be held.
Staff at JobcentrePlus will advise you on:
- Benefits
- The best steps for moving forward for work
- Work that suits you
- How to prepare for work
